Northrop Grumman Aeronautics Sector (NGAS) is seeking a Principal Industrial Security Analyst (ISA3) to join our team of qualified, diverse individuals in Melbourne, Florida.
The selected candidate will have the responsibility of developing and administering security programs and procedures for classified or proprietary materials, documents, and equipment in a fast-paced, high-profile portfolio of programs. In this role, the selected candidate will:

Basic Qualifications:
5 Years with Bachelors; 3 Years with Masters; 1 Year with PhD OR an additional 4 Years of Industrial Security or related experience will be considered in lieu of a degree
Candidate must be a US Citizen
Must have Active U.S. Government Secret security clearance with in-scope investigation (T5, T5R, SSBI, SBPR, PR) completed within the last 6 years or current enrollment in Continuous Evaluation (CE) program
Ability to meet enhanced security requirements and obtain/maintain SAP eligibility and access
Knowledge of the Department of Defense Manual 5205.07; 32 CFR Part 17 National Industrial Security Program Operating Manual (NISPOM)
Preferred Qualifications:
Bachelor's Degree
Active Top-Secret clearance with ability to obtain and maintain SAP access
Strong leadership skills to include: Self-starter with minimal supervision, high ethical standards, organized and efficient at time management
Strong interpersonal skills to communicate effectively, 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ously, make decisions in the midst of ambiguity and meet deadlines
Experience with Supply Chain Security process and procedures
Highly organized with ability to manage multiple priorities and time sensitive deliverables
